摘要: 目的:比较超声和增强CT在头颈部鳞状细胞癌(头颈部鳞癌,head and neck squamous cell carcinoma,HNSCC)患者颈部淋巴结转移的诊断效能,并建立预测模型以提高早期诊断的准确性。方法:选取2022年11月—2024年4月上海交通大学医学院附属第九人民医院接受颈淋巴清扫术的原发HNSCC患者125例,收集其超声和增强CT数据及原发灶和淋巴结转移情况等术后病理信息,按7∶3比例随机分为模型组和验证组。在建模阶段,采用多因素logistic回归模型筛选出颈淋巴结转移的预测因素,并构建列线图。采用ROC曲线下面积和校准曲线评估模型的区分度和校准度,采用临床决策曲线评估模型的临床应用价值。结果:多因素logistic回归模型结果显示,淋巴结最大径、原发灶浸润深度、肿瘤细胞分化程度以及患者年龄对颈淋巴结转移的诊断具有显著影响(P<0.05)。基于这些危险因素建立风险列线图预测模型,ROC曲线下面积和校准曲线显示模型的区分度和准确度良好。临床决策曲线分析显示,模型在较大的阈值内具有一定临床实用性。结论:超声对HNSCC患者颈淋巴结转移的诊断价值优于增强CT。本研究构建的HNSCC颈淋巴结转移列线图模型预测效果良好,可为临床预测HNSCC颈淋巴结转移提供参考。

Abstract: PURPOSE: To compare the diagnostic efficacy of ultrasound and enhanced CT in the diagnosis of cervical lymph node metastasis in patients with head and neck squamous cell carcinoma(HNSCC), and establish a predictive model to improve the accuracy of early diagnosis. METHODS: A total of 125 patients with primary HNSCC who underwent neck lymph node dissection at Shanghai Ninth People's Hospital Affiliated to Shanghai Jiao Tong University School of Medicine from November 2022 to April 2024 were selected. Their ultrasound and enhanced CT data, as well as information on primary lesion pathology and cervical lymph node metastasis, were collected and randomly divided into a modeling group and a validation group in a 7∶3 ratio. In the modeling phase, a multi-factor logistic regression model was used to screen for predictive factors of cervical lymph node metastasis, and a column chart was constructed based on these variables. The area under the ROC curve and calibration curve were used to evaluate the discrimination and calibration of the model. The clinical application value of the model was evaluated using clinical decision curves. RESULTS: The results of multiple logistic regression model showed that the maximum diameter of lymph nodes, the depth of primary lesion infiltration, the degree of differentiation, and the age of the patients had a significant impact on the diagnosis of cervical lymph node metastasis (P<0.05). Based on these risk factors, a risk column chart prediction model was established, and the area under the ROC curve and calibration curve showed good discrimination and accuracy of the model. Clinical decision curve analysis showed that the model has certain clinical practicality within a large threshold. CONCLUSIONS: Overall, ultrasound is superior to enhanced CT in the diagnosis of cervical lymph node metastasis in patients with head and neck squamous cell carcinoma. The column chart model of cervical lymph node metastasis constructed in this study has a good predictive effect and can provide reference for clinical prediction of lymph node metastasis in head and neck squamous cell carcinoma.
